Implant failure can occur for various reasons. One common concern is infection, usually arising from poor oral hygiene. Peri-implantitis, a particular sort of gum disease affecting the soft and hard tissues surrounding the implant, can result in significant bone loss and, ultimately, failure of the implant.

Dental implants require a strong basis, and when the jawbone lacks the necessary density or volume, attaining the needed stability becomes challenging. In such circumstances, implants could not fuse correctly with the bone, rising the risk of failure

Misalignment during implantation can also lead to issues. If an implant is not positioned accurately, it may expertise undue stress or stress when chewing. This misalignment can result in implant failure or make it more doubtless for the surrounding teeth to endure from put on or injury.

Smoking is a major risk factor, as it could possibly impede healing and increase the chance of infections. Additionally, conditions similar to uncontrolled diabetes can impair therapeutic, additional complicating the dental implant course of


When a dental implant fails, the patient's quick concern typically revolves around what may be accomplished next. Fortunately, dental implants can usually get replaced if they fail. However, the process is not as simple as merely inserting a new implant in the same spot.

Before replacing a failed implant, a comprehensive evaluation is required to determine the underlying reason for the failure. Addressing these issues is crucial to ensuring a successful replacement. If infection was an element, the dental skilled will need to clear it up, which may involve therapies for peri-implantitis or bettering oral hygiene practices.


Should bone density be an issue, additional procedures could be required. Bone grafting might be essential to rebuild the jawbone, providing a sturdy basis for the model new implant. This further procedure can add time to the general treatment plan, however it is often essential for long-term success.

It's also vital to wait an acceptable period of time after the elimination of a failed implant earlier than attempting a replacement. Once the location has healed, and any underlying points have been handled, the replacement of the dental implant can proceed. The means of inserting a new implant typically follows the same steps as the original placement, with cautious consideration to alignment and positioning to keep away from earlier errors.


While most individuals can receive a replacement implant, there are some issues that a dental professional should consider. For instance, the patient’s general health, habits, and oral hygiene become extra significant elements after experiencing a failure. More robust screening will often occur to make sure all potential risks are mitigated.

The success rate for replacement dental implants is usually constructive. Many sufferers discover that after addressing the reasons for the failure, their new implant integrates efficiently with the jawbone and functions well for years. Satisfaction levels could be quite high, provided that people keep regular dental check-ups and practice good oral hygiene.

Ongoing care performs a critical function in the long-term success of dental implants. Routine cleanings and monitoring by a dental professional help catch potential issues before they escalate. Maintaining good oral hygiene at residence, including brushing twice daily and flossing, is equally essential in ensuring the longevity of the dental implant.


Psychological impacts also exist when dental implants fail. Patients could experience nervousness or disappointment, significantly if they've invested time and money into the process. Addressing these emotional concerns is as essential because the bodily elements of recovery and maintenance.
